Bioplastic Packaging Bag Market

The global bioplastic packaging bag market is currently riding a wave of momentum. According to projections, the market will reach approximately USD 16.4 billion by 2025, and it’s expected to soar to a staggering USD 61.9 billion by 2035. This rapid expansion represents a compound annual growth rate (CAGR) of 14.2% from 2025 to 2035.

As the global conversation shifts towards sustainability, industries across the board are rethinking their environmental footprint. At the heart of this movement is a transformative force in packaging the bioplastic packaging bag. Once considered a niche solution, bioplastic packaging is now emerging as a powerful alternative to conventional petroleum-based plastics.

Bioplastics are a type of plastic derived from renewable biomass sources, such as corn starch, sugarcane, or cellulose. Unlike conventional plastics made from fossil fuels, bioplastic packaging bags are designed to reduce carbon emissions, lessen environmental damage, and provide biodegradable or compostable end-of-life solutions.

Sustainability and Consumer Demand Driving Growth

One of the key factors driving the growth of the bioplastic packaging bag market is the increasing consumer demand for sustainable and eco-friendly alternatives to traditional plastic products. As global awareness about environmental issues like plastic pollution grows, consumers are becoming more conscious of the products they purchase and their impact on the planet.

Bioplastic packaging bags, made from renewable biological feedstocks such as corn starch, sugarcane, or algae, offer a solution that reduces dependence on fossil fuels, thereby mitigating carbon footprints.

Key Takeaways From the Bioplastic Packaging Bag Market

  • The United States is expected to lead the market with a strong CAGR of 14.5% from 2025 to 2035.
  • South Korea follows closely, projected to grow at a CAGR of 14.3% during the same period.
  • The European Union is also set for significant expansion, with a CAGR of 14.1%.
  • The United Kingdom demonstrates healthy growth with a projected CAGR of 13.9%.
  • Japan rounds out the group with a steady CAGR of 13.8%, reflecting increasing adoption in the Asia-Pacific region.

Key Driving Factors of Bioplastic Packaging Bag Market

  • Environmental Concerns and Sustainability: Growing awareness of plastic pollution and environmental degradation is driving demand for bioplastic packaging bags as a sustainable alternative to traditional plastic bags. Bioplastics, derived from renewable sources like plant-based materials, offer a more eco-friendly solution.
  • Government Regulations and Policies: Stringent government regulations and policies aimed at reducing single-use plastic waste are encouraging the adoption of bioplastics. Many countries have introduced bans or restrictions on plastic bags, creating a shift toward bioplastic alternatives.
  • Advancements in Bioplastic Technology: Continuous innovations and advancements in bioplastic production, such as improved processing techniques and the development of stronger, more durable materials, are enhancing the functionality and appeal of bioplastic packaging bags.
  • Corporate Sustainability Initiatives: Many companies are adopting green packaging solutions as part of their corporate social responsibility (CSR) efforts. As businesses aim to reduce their environmental footprint, bioplastic packaging bags are becoming a preferred choice for eco-conscious brands.

Key Company Offerings and Activities

  • Novamont S.p.A.: Develops compostable bioplastic bags made from renewable raw materials.
  • BASF SE: Produces certified biodegradable plastics for various packaging applications.
  • NatureWorks LLC: Specializes in PLA-based bioplastic packaging solutions for food and retail sectors.
  • Mitsubishi Chemical Holdings: Innovates in bio-based polymer packaging materials with enhanced durability.
  • Biome Bioplastics: Focuses on plant-based and compostable plastic alternatives for sustainable packaging.
